Summary
DPSS combines Ann Arbor, Dearborn, and Flint operations to provide a safe and secure environment for students, faculty, and staff while improving their overall quality of life. Through our partnerships across the university and local, state, and federal law enforcement agencies, we use a blended service model to meet the needs of our community and exceed expectations. With more than 500 employees across 12 departments, DPSS operations include an array of services from community engagement, safety programming, and training to emergency planning and preparedness, and safety and security.
The Human Resources Generalist reports to the Associate Director, assisting with functions for DPSS. You will assist the Associate Director with short- and long-term HR strategies in alignment with DPSS's pillars, mission, vision, and values.

Responsibilities*
You Will:
- Partner with unit leaders and managers to identify and address workforce issues, gaps, and needs
- Consult with unit leaders and managers regarding performance concerns; design and help implement development plans and corrective actions
- Coach and educate unit leaders and managers, supervisors, and employees on Talent Management-related HR guidelines, as well as identify metrics to analyze and make recommendations to unit leaders to act on to support their workforce objectives and priorities, employee engagement, management best practices, coaching and counseling process, conflict resolution, interpersonal communications, and effective team interaction
- Partner with departments to ensure alignment with staff onboarding programs
- Collaborate with the DPSS HR team related to performance management, onboarding, and training and work closely with HR colleagues on related communications, training, participation tracking, and program effectiveness
- Other duties as assigned
Required Qualifications*
You Have:
- A Bachelor's degree in human resources, business administration, or a related field or an equivalent combination of education and experience
- Five (5) years of human resources management experience, including recruiting, performance management, employee and labor relations
- Demonstrated written and verbal communication skills with members of senior management
- Experience with Google Suite and Microsoft Office applications
- Customer focus, teamwork, flexibility, and creativity while working in a deadline-driven environment
- Working knowledge of relevant federal and state employment laws

Additional Information
All members of the Division of Public Safety and Security (DPSS) are considered Campus Security Authorities (CSAs) under The Jeanne Clery Disclosure of Campus Security Policy and Campus Crime Statistics Act.
As such, you are required to report Clery reportable offenses that come to your attention. DPSS employees are required to complete Clery Compliance Training within the first 14 days of employment and annually thereafter.
